Free To Play Indie Game Pc GamesGame publisher OYA Play announced that its multiplayer party game, WHAT THE PAK?!, has seen a significant increase in popularity since becoming free to keep on Steam for a limited time. From June 10 to June 17, 2025, over 2.28 million users added the game to their library, leading to a total player count of over 180,000 and over 10,000 hours of watched game streaming on Twitch.
WHAT THE PAK?! is a chaotic multiplayer game featuring ugly-cute creatures called "Paks" that compete in various mini-games. The game offers a dynamic experience with random mini-games, global events, and character customization options. OYA Play and the development team plan to add new mini-games, game modes, visual enhancements, and social features in the future.
Assad Dar, CEO of OYA Play, expressed his excitement about the game's success and the company's commitment to delivering value to the gaming community. OYA Play focuses on creating lasting gaming experiences and supporting developers with publishing services, market insights, and go-to-market strategies.
Launched on Steam until June 24, WHAT THE PAK?! offers a unique and engaging experience for players looking to join the ongoing chaos. The game's success highlights the potential for growth in the party game genre and the impact of free-to-keep promotions on user acquisition and engagement.
